Hello all. I don't normally make a habit of clicking on the click baity stuff (I actually clicked this one by mistake, but then I started reading it). I thought this was quite interesting actually.

I'm not going to do these scammers the courtesy of linking to their page, so I'll copy it here. I'm sure if you search for the text you can find it if you're really interested. I will say that their website name was designed to mimic a well known site using a clever subdomain: wellknownsite).com-***.net

There are definitely some good sales and copy techniques used, however I found quite a few things that were funny about it.
1. "Ellen" secretly launched a product without her name association because she wanted to make sure her company "could stand on its own two feet" but yet there's no issue using it now.
2. Celebrity photos and endorsements (how could we verify they said those things?)
3. People on facebook supposedly endorsed the product as well, but then I click on the (yes, actual Facebook) links and see one of two things:

I doubt the actual Shark Tank show is behind this. I also doubt that starting a lawsuit would have any effect whatsoever (the webserver is probably in a different country).

Apparently the messages got so bad that some people even shut down their Facebook accounts (or they were never real to begin with):

Farther down in the comments on the real Facebook account, people were talking about how they had monthly $100+ billings that they were only able to stop by canceling their credit card.

Pretty effing shitty way to make money if you ask me.
